1.Prognostic Significance of Pretreatment 18FALF-NOTA-FAPI-04 PET/CT in Patients With Recurrent Gastric Cancer Undergoing Combined PD-1 Inhibitor and Chemotherapy
Haifeng HE ; Yongzhi XIE ; Chengzhi JIANG ; Wanjing ZHOU ; Hui YE
Korean Journal of Radiology 2026;27(3):264-275
Objective:
This study aimed to evaluate the prognostic value of [ 18F]ALF-NOTA-FAPI-04 PET/CT-derived parameters, including the maximum standardized uptake value (SUVmax), FAPI-avid tumor volume (FTV), and total lesion FAP expression (TLF), in patients with recurrent gastric cancer undergoing combined chemoimmunotherapy. We sought to establish a noninvasive imaging biomarker framework to optimize patient stratification and therapeutic decision-making.
Materials and Methods:
This retrospective cohort study analyzed 51 patients with recurrent gastric cancer who received programmed cell death protein 1 (PD-1) inhibitors combined with chemotherapy after gastrectomy. All patients underwent [ 18F]ALF-NOTA-FAPI-04 PET/CT within 14 days of chemoimmunotherapy. Semi-quantitative parameters (SUVmax, FTV, and TLF) were derived using semi-automated tumor segmentation. The primary endpoint of this study was the assessment of the clinical efficacy of chemoimmunotherapy, categorized as a durable or nondurable clinical benefit. The secondary endpoints included progression-free survival (PFS) and overall survival (OS). In a subgroup of 16 patients who underwent sequential [ 18F]FDG PET/CT within seven days of [ 18F]ALF-NOTA-FAPI-04 PET/CT, tracer uptake values were compared between the two PET/CT examinations.
Results:
51 patients were included. The median PFS and OS were 7 and 10 months, respectively. Durable clinical benefit (DCB) was observed in 30 patients and showed significantly lower SUVmax, FTV, and TLF values than non-DCB. TLF demonstrated the highest diagnostic accuracy for DCB (area under the receiver operating characteristic curve [AUC] = 0.80). Multivariable analysis identified TLF ≥ 188.88 SUVbw·cm 3 as an independent factor associated with PFS (hazard ratio [HR] = 7.29, P = 0.001) and FTV ≥ 44.17 cm 3 as an independent factor associated with OS (HR = 5.16, P = 0.010). In the subgroup analysis of 16 patients, semi-quantitative analysis demonstrated consistently higher values of [ 18F]ALF-NOTA-FAPI-04-derived parameters than [ 18F]FDG-derived parameters (all P < 0.001).
Conclusion
[ 18F]ALF-NOTA-FAPI-04 PET/CT may be a useful imaging tool for predicting clinical outcomes in patients with recurrent gastric cancer undergoing treatment with PD-1 inhibitors and chemotherapy.
2.Abnormal Gait Recognition of Patients with Stroke Based on Deep Learning Fusion
Chenhao LI ; Peng YANG ; Chenglong FENG ; Haifeng ZHANG ; Chenghua JIANG ; Wenxin NIU
Journal of Medical Biomechanics 2025;40(4):955-962
Objective To address the personalized differences in motion gait between stroke patients and healthy older adults,as well as the issue of abnormal gait recognition,a deep learning fusion-based approach is proposed to effectively improve the accuracy of abnormal gait recognition.Methods A model fusing convolutional neural networks(CNN)and bidirectional long short-term memory networks(BiLSTM)was adopted,with the introduction of a residual network(ResNet).Unilateral ankle joint movement data at different walking speeds within a comfortable range were collected from healthy older adults and stroke patients.Signals from inertial sensors and electromyography sensors were used as inputs,while gait features were analyzed and gait differences between the two groups were compared.The effectiveness of the model was validated by comparing the classification performance of traditional deep learning models and CNN-ResNet-BiLSTM models with different layer combinations in terms of abnormal gait recognition accuracy.Results The CNN-ResNet-BiLSTM model,which introduced residual connectivity,performed excellently in abnormal gait recognition.Compared with traditional deep learning models such as the gated recurrent unit(GRU)and long short-term memory network(LSTM),its prediction accuracy was improved by 13.6%and 8.36%,respectively.Additionally,compared with other model combinations,this model achieved an overall accuracy of 97.78%.Conclusions The algorithm proposed in this study can be applied to stroke-related abnormal gait detection,providing technique support for the early diagnosis and precise monitoring of such diseases.
3.A randomized controlled study on the effect of intermittent theta burst stimulation on craving,mood,and cognitive function in alcohol-dependent patients during the withdrawal period
Haihong WANG ; Chenxin YUAN ; Hong GAN ; Haifeng JIANG ; Yan ZHAO ; Jiang DU ; Yi ZHANG
Journal of Shanghai Jiaotong University(Medical Science) 2025;45(3):349-356
Objective·To explore the effect of intermittent theta burst stimulation(iTBS)targeting the left dorsolateral prefrontal cortex(DLPFC)on reducing craving in alcohol-dependent patients during the withdrawal period,as well as its impact on patients'emotions and cognitive functions.Methods·A total of 41 inpatients with alcohol dependence in the withdrawal period were recruited from the Addiction Department of Mental Health Center,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ine,and randomly assigned to the experimental group(20 patients)and the control group(21 patients).Both groups received routine inpatient treatment for alcohol-dependence.The experimental group received real iTBS stimulation targeting the left DLPFC on the basis of routine inpatient treatment,while the control group received sham stimulation with the same parameters.The intervention course lasted for 2 weeks,with a total of 10 sessions.The Visual Analogue Scale(VAS),Beck Depression Inventory(BDI),and Beck Anxiety Inventory(BAI)were used to measure the craving,anxiety,and depression of the patients before and after the intervention.The behavioral tasks of the detection task(DET),identification task(IDN),two back task(TWOB),the Groton maze learning task(GML),and international shopping list task(ISL)in the CogState software package were used to assess the cognitive processing speed,attention/vigilance,working memory,spatial problem-solving/error monitoring ability,and verbal learning and memory of the patients before and after the intervention.Results·Repeated measures ANOVA showed that the time effect[F=126.713,P<0.001,partial η2(ηp2)=0.765]and interaction effect(F=7.080.P=0.011,ηp2=0.154)of the VAS scores in the two groups of patients were statistically significant.The time effect(F=9.114,P=0.004,ηp2=0.189),group effect(F=5.557,P=0.024,ηp2=0.125),and interaction effect(F=4.977,P=0.032,η2=0.113)of the TWOB score were all statistically significant.Only the time effects of BDI(F=45.273,P<0.001,ηp2=0.578),BAI(F=31.432,P<0.001,ηp2=0.473),GML(F=8.993,P=0.005,ηp2=0.209),and ISL(F=26.657,P<0.001,ηp2=0.439)scores were statistically significant.There were no statistically significant effects of time,group,or interaction on the DET and IDN scores.Simple effect analysis showed that the VAS score of the real stimulation group was lower than that of the sham stimulation group after the intervention(F=8.805,P=0.005,ηp2=0.184),and the TWOB score of the real stimulation group was higher than that of the sham stimulation group(F=11.293,P=0.002,ηp2=0.225).Conclusion·Combining iTBS with routine inpatient treatment can enhance the efficacy of reducing alcohol craving in alcohol-dependent patients during the withdrawal period,and improve their working memory.
4.Evaluation of the reliability and validity of the Chinese listening self-efficacy questionnaire
Wenling JIANG ; Junyan ZHU ; Qian ZHOU ; Yuqi JIN ; Yan REN ; Haifeng LI ; Zhi-wu HUANG
Journal of Audiology and Speech Pathology 2025;33(2):134-139
Objective To develop and translate the Chinese listening self-efficacy questionnaire(C-LSEQ)and to test its reliability and validity.Methods A total of 172 subjects aged≥60 years with age-related hearing loss completed the C-LSEQ questionnaire via direct interviews.Pure tone hearing threshold test,Mandarin hearing in noise test,and the hearing handicap inventory for elderly-screening(HHIE-S)were evaluated.Twenty subjects were randomly selected from the original group to complete the C-LSEQ questionnaire in 2 weeks after the initial evaluation.Results ① Reliability:The Cronbach's a coefficients of the three sub-dimensions and the overall ques-tionnaire were all>0.8,and the test-retest reliability coefficients of the three sub-dimensions and the overall ques-tionnaire were all>0.9(P<0.001).② Validity:The experts collectively evaluated the representativeness of the statements with good content validity.The convergent validity test showed that the composite reliability(CR)of the 2 sub-dimensions and the overall questionnaire were all>0.7,and the average variance extracted(AVE)were all>0.5.The CR value of the complex listening dimension was 0.655,and the AVE value was 0.937.The criterion validity test showed that the overall questionnaire and the three sub-dimensions of the C-LSEQ were significantly correlated with the pure-tone average,speech recognition thresholds in noise,and HHIE-S(P<0.001).Conclusion The C-LSEQ exhibits stable structure,with good reliability and validity.It can be used to assess listen-ing self-efficacy in adults with hearing loss,especially in the elderly with age-related hearing loss.
5.Pregabalin abuse leading to addiction: a case report
Yujian YE ; Yan ZHAO ; Meiti WANG ; Yin CUI ; Junfeng LIANG ; Haifeng JIANG ; Jiang DU
Chinese Journal of Psychiatry 2025;58(7):553-555
Pregabalin, a structural analog of γ-aminobutyric acid (GABA), has been widely prescribed since its approval in 2004 for treating various neuropathic pain conditions. In Western countries, it is also approved for managing anxiety disorders. However, concerns about its potential for abuse and dependence have led to its reclassification as a second-line treatment in recent years. Although pregabalin addiction has been reported in international studies, there have been no such reports within China. This article presents a case of addiction stemming from pregabalin abuse to manage anxiety symptoms. The patient experienced withdrawal symptoms after discontinuing the drug, which were successfully treated. The development of pregabalin addiction, withdrawal symptoms, and the OD(overdose) pattern of drug abuse in this case should draw the attention of clinicians in China.

8.Discussion on the Differentiation and Treatment of Migraine and Acupuncture Treatment from"Spleen and Stomach Disorders"
Jiawei FENG ; Yiwen JIANG ; Haifeng ZHANG
Journal of Zhejiang Chinese Medical University 2025;49(8):1054-1057
[Objective]To propose syndrome differentiation and treatment approach of acupuncture for migraine based on the relationship between"spleen and stomach disorders"and the etiology and pathogenesis of migraine,providing theoretical and practical references for the clinical management.[Methods]The connotation of"spleen and stomach disorders"and its association with migraine were systematically reviewed.Based on this perspective,treatment strategies and acupuncture prescriptions for migraine were formulated,and supported by a representative clinical case study.[Results]"Spleen and stomach disorders"serves as a critical pathological foundation for migraine.Its pathogenesis can be summarized into four patterns"impaired spleen transport leading to malnourishment of the brain""phlegm-dampness obstructing the orifices and impairing mental clarity""spleen-stomach disharmony causing Qi stagnation"and"spleen deficiency with blood stasis resulting in orifice obstruction".Acupuncture treatment should prioritize regulating spleen-stomach function,supplemented by dredging local meridians and harmonizing Qi and blood.Key acupoints include Zhongwan(CV12),Xiawan(CV10),Qihai(CV6),and Guanyuan(CV4)for reinforcing primordial Qi,consolidating the foundation,and harmonizing Qi and blood;Zusanli(ST36),Shangjuxu(ST37)and Xiajuxu(ST39)for regulating Qi movement and balancing Yin and Yang;Sizhukong(TE23)and Fengchi(GB20)for clearing the head,improving vision,and relieving pain.In the presented case,the patient was diagnosed as dual deficiency of Qi and blood,acupuncture therapy focusing on replenishing Qi,nourishing blood and unblocking collaterals achieved significant clinical efficacy.[Conclusion]"Spleen and stomach disorders"is a pivotal mechanism underlying recurrent migraine.Acupuncture treatment for migraine should emphasize restoring spleen-stomach function,prioritizing the reinforcement of primordial Qi and harmonization of Qi and blood,thereby addressing the root cause to reduce migraine recurrence.
9.The relationship between EZH2 methylation and thyroid cancer differentiation-related markers and its therapeutic value
Lin Jing ; Qi Jiang ; Jiangning Gu ; Haifeng Luo ; Xiaoyi Guo ; Tianci Shen ; Zihao Dai ; Dan Chen
Acta Universitatis Medicinalis Anhui 2025;60(4):691-696, 706
Objective :
To investigate the role of enhancer of zeste homolog 2(EZH2)-trimethylated lysine 27 of histone H3(H3K27me3) axis in the dedifferentiation of thyroid cancer and its clinical value as a potential target for the treatment of anaplastic thyroid cancer(ATC).
Methods :
Immunohistochemical SP method was used to detect the expression of EZH2, H3K27me3, paired box gene 8(PAX8), thyroglobulin(TG) and thyroid transcription factor 1(TTF1) in ATC and papillary thyroid carcinoma(PTC) and their adjacent tissues. The relationship between EZH2 and thyroid differentiation markers(PAX8, TTF1, TG) was further analyzed by gene expression omnibus(GEO) database. ATC cell lines 8305C and BHT-101 were culturedin vitro. Real-time reverse transcription PCR(RT-qPCR) was used to detect the expression of thyroid differentiation markers(TTF1, PAX8) mRNA in ATC cell lines treated with EZH2 inhibitor(GSK126), and evaluate the potential therapeutic effect of GSK126in vitro. The effects of GSK126 and BRAF inhibitor vemurafenib on the proliferation of ATC cell lines were observed by cell proliferation assay.
Results :
The expression of EZH2 in ATC tissues was significantly higher than that in papillary thyroid carcinoma and adjacent tissues(P<0.05). The expression of H3K37me3 in ATC tissues was significantly lower than that in PTC tissues(P<0.05). EZH2 was negatively correlated with PAX8 and TG expression levels, but not with TTF1 expression level.In vitroexperiments, GSK126 could reverse the expression of thyroid differentiation markers PAX8 and TTF1 in ATC cell lines. GSK126 combined with BRAF inhibitor vemurafenib could significantly inhibit the growth of ATC cell lines.
Conclusion
The EZH2-H3K27me3 axis plays an important role in regulating thyroid specific markers, and the inhibition of EZH2 by small molecular compounds is a promising target for ATC treatment in the future.
10.Intensive preoperative functional training can improve the balance and functional recovery of persons undergoing total knee arthroplasty
Genchun GUO ; Zhenhua ZHU ; Wanlang LI ; Feixiang MA ; Lei JIANG ; Haifeng LI ; Honghua DONG
Chinese Journal of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ation 2025;47(8):727-733
Objective:To explore the effect of preoperative intensive functional training on the balance and functional recovery of patients with knee osteoarthritis (KOA) receiving total knee arthroplasty (TKA).Methods:Sixty KOA patients were randomly divided into an outpatient group, a home-based group and a control group, each of 20. Before their TKAs, both the outpatient and home-based groups underwent intensive functional training for 4 weeks, while the control group did nothing special. After the TKA, all received 4 weeks of standardized postoperative rehabilitation training. Before any training, after the 4 weeks of preoperative training and 4 weeks after the TKAs, all of the subjects performed the timed up and go test (TUGT), and their joint range of motion (ROM) was recorded. They also completed the 30-second chair stand strength test (30sCST), and the 6-minute walk exercise endurance test (6MWT). KOA osteoarthritis indices (WOMACs) were also recorded.Results:After the 4 weeks of preoperative training, significant differences were observed in the trajectory length, elliptical area and TUGT times of both the outpatient and home-based groups. Four weeks after the TKAs, significant differences were observed in all of the measurements in all three groups, but the results of the outpatient and home-based groups were significantly better than those of the control group, on average. After the 4 weeks of postoperative training, there were significant differences between the outpatient and home-based groups in terms of the average knee flexion angle, knee extension angle, 30sCST and 6MWT results. There were significant differences among the 3 groups in all of the measurements 4 weeks after the TKAs, with those of the two training groups showing significantly better results than the control group. The pain scores, stiffness scores, function scores and total WOMAC scores had improved significantly compared with the control group, but the average function and total WOMAC scores of the outpatient group (24.25±2.38) and (35.41±3.02) were then significantly superior to the home-based group′s averages.Conclusions:Intensive preoperative functional training conducted in an outpatient clinic or at home can significantly improve the balance, lower limb strength, exercise endurance and symptoms of KOA patients after TKA.
